In 2008, Roy Williams, a Marion native, famously said he would rather beat the Wolfpack than eat. While coaching at Kansas in 2002, Williams said he was watching a UNC-NC State game on TV, which featured a large contingent of red-clad Wolfpack fans at the Smith Center during a season in which the Tar Heels limped to an 8-20 finish under coach Matt Doherty.
